
Rodger Berman
Rodger Berman is a business executive known for leading the finance, business development, and brand strategy of Rachel Zoe, Inc. He is also known for appearing alongside Rachel Zoe on The Rachel Zoe Project and Fashionably Late with Rachel Zoe.
Personal life
Berman met fashion stylist Rachel Zoe in 1991 while working as a waiter in Washington, D.C. They married on February 14, 1998, and have two sons, Skyler Morrison Berman and Kaius Jagger Berman.
Berman and Zoe announced their separation in September 2024. Zoe filed for divorce in July 2025.
Leadership at Rachel Zoe, Inc.
Berman has served as president of Rachel Zoe, Inc., where he manages finance, legal matters, employee oversight, business development, and brand strategy. He works with Zoe on the overall direction of the brand, negotiates licensing partnerships, and pursues opportunities to extend the Rachel Zoe name.
His responsibilities have also included leading the growth of the Rachel Zoe Collection and CURATEUR. He serves as co-CEO of both lifestyle brands and oversees the company's investment strategy through Rachel Zoe Venture Partners.
Recognition Media and investment work
Before joining Rachel Zoe's business, Berman worked as an investment banker for eight years. He later co-founded Recognition Media and served as its president. The company owned and produced internet, media, and advertising industry programs and events including the Webby Awards and Internet Week.
Berman has also worked as an entrepreneur and investor in media and technology. His investment interests include fashion, retail, media and content, consumer health, and marketplaces, and he serves on advisory boards for technology start-ups.
Television appearances
Berman appeared with Zoe on The Rachel Zoe Project, which aired from 2008 to 2013. He later appeared on Fashionably Late with Rachel Zoe, beginning in 2015.
His television appearances presented his role in Zoe's business and their life as a couple, alongside the development of the Rachel Zoe brand.
Education
Berman earned a bachelor's degree in finance from George Washington University in 1990. He received an M.B.A. in international business from the university in 1991.
